Why The Glass Matters So Much
In a place like Alabama, a window does not just need to look good, it has to slow down heat, manage glare, and keep the cooling system from working overtime.
That is why low-E glass windows for hot Alabama summers are usually the first feature worth paying attention to.
A low-E surface does not block all sunlight, but it cuts the kind of heat that makes rooms uncomfortable in the afternoon.

How To Read Window Ratings Without Guessing
The rating tag matters because it tells you how the window behaves in real weather, not just how it looks in the showroom.
The two ratings worth understanding are U-factor and SHGC.
If a house gets strong afternoon sun, the right combination can make a room feel less sticky without forcing the HVAC system to compensate as often.
A great SHGC with weak frame insulation can still underperform, and a highly insulated frame with poor solar control may not solve the real problem.

The Part Homeowners Do Not See
Air leaks around the frame, gaps in the rough opening, and weak flashing can undo a lot of the benefit of a high-quality product.
A reputable contractor will know whether the job needs a permit, what inspections may apply, and how the work should be sealed and finished.
If the old frame is left with hidden rot or the opening is not flashed correctly, hot air and moisture can get where they should not.
